Transaction 309e3582c6e314f926a0481b0805e94c9797951b17517b4853912fabac8dabd0
1 Input
1 Output
-
309e3582c6e314f926a0481b0805e94c9797951b17517b4853912fabac8dabd0:0
- value
- 29988
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a9262e1679d61ba8efcfebec47da8f9678ce4182 OP_EQUAL
- address
- 3H7PrkvZTUsBdz9iETZEpWoLJmRw689ucX